Which of the following is currently the only fixative available that does not contain formalin, polyvinyl alcohol (PVA), or mercury?
a. Merthiolate-iodine-formalin (MIF)
b. Sodium acetate–acetic acid–formalin (SAF)
c. ECOFIX
d. TOTAL-FIX
D
Currently, TOTAL-FIX is the only fixative that contains no formalin, PVA, or mercury. Exam-ples of semi-universal fixatives are SAF, which has no mercury or PVA but contains formalin; and ECOFIX, which has no mercury or formalin but contains PVA. MIF contains formalin.
